Introduction
Laird Technologies is a global leader in designing and supplying customized, mission-critical products for wireless and other advanced electronics applications. The company works with customers to develop solutions for applications across multiple industries, including automotive electronics, computing, consumer electronics, data communications, medical devices, networking equipment, and telecommunications. Laird Technologies designs and manufactures a broad range of vehicle-mounted mobile radio antennas from 27MHz to 5.8GHz, with multiple mounting options available. Its patented no-whip Phantom and Phantom Elite low-profile antenna series delivers true field diversity performance, complemented by traditional mobile coil antennas, economy quarter-wave antennas, and A-base mount products.
Features
- Patented Phantom series antennas for outdoor or indoor applications, available in standard, low-profile, and stealth Phantom Elite models, featuring field diversity with both vertical and horizontal polarization components, offering diversity, frequency flexibility, low visibility, wide bandwidth, and low-angle radiation patterns.
- Compatible with VHF, UHF, 800/900, 2.4, 5.8GHz, and multi-band cellular and GPS frequencies.
- 3dB MEG outperforms conventional 3dB antennas in many applications.
- Available in standard NMO, permanent, direct N-female, and ceiling tile mounting options.
- Damage-resistant.
- Thousands of units deployed worldwide.
- Phantom Elite antennas combine stealth design with patented field diversity technology, providing vertical and horizontal polarization, featuring a patented "whip-free" design that counters signal fading in highly reflective urban or mobile environments, constructed with field-proven ABS injection-molded materials.
- Laird Technologies' mobile loaded coil antennas are the most technically advanced on the market, refined through years of mechanical and electrical design improvements.
